I think you might have better luck convincing your friends to let you sleep on the sofa. Usually house sitting jobs are given to people one knows personally. And they aren't easy to come by at that.

I agree with EE. It is very unlikely that you will find such a job. People who don't want to rent and don't want their house empty are going to find a friend, a friend of a friend, a child of a friend, their child's school teacher ... well, you get the idea. Otherwise, they'd rent the house out.
